YTL Power International Bhd  (OTCPK:YTLPF) 1-Year Sharpe Ratio Explanation

The 1-Year Sharpe Ratio inidicates the risk-adjusted return of an investment over the past year. It is calculated as the annualized result of the average monthly excess return divided by its standard deviation over the past year. The monthly excess return is the monthly investment return minus the monthly risk-free rate (typically the 10-year Treasury Constant Maturity Rate). If the risk-free rate for a specific region is not available, U.S. data is used by default.

The greater a portfolio's Sharpe Ratio, the better its risk-adjusted performance. A negative Sharpe Ratio means the risk-free rate is greater than the portfolio’s historical or projected return, or else the portfolio's return is expected to be negative.

YTL Power International Bhd Business Description

Other Exchanges 6742:Malaysia
Address 205 Jalan Bukit Bintang, 34th Floor, Menara YTL, Kuala Lumpur, SGR, MYS, 55100
YTL Power International Bhd is a multi-utility owner and operator with operations and investments across Asia and Europe, including Malaysia, Singapore, the UK, Indonesia, Jordan, the Netherlands, Thailand, and China. It produces energy through subsidiaries operating combined-cycle, gas-fired, steam, and co-generation power plants. The company's segments are Power Generation its main revenue source, Water & Sewage, Telecommunications, and Investment Holding Activities. These segments provide electricity generation, water supply and wastewater treatment, ICT services including 4G/5G and AI cloud computing, and investment management across its markets. The company operates in Malaysia, Singapore, the United Kingdom, and other countries, with the majority of revenue coming from Singapore.
